I am going to start off by saying this: I am absolutely in love with vintage/neo-vintage Breguets so I might be highly biased about this 3330. But this 3330 Breguet rightfully has all the reasons to compliment. Featuring Day, Date, as well as Moonphase function, this dial design is based on Breguet’s pocket watch ref.3833 from the 1800s.

Since the acquisition, I spend too much time staring at the Clos de Paris and Grain D’Orge patterned Guilloché dial; more than I would like to admit. In terms of the dial layout, the placement of 3 sub registers: very much inspired by the ref.3833 pocket watch is laid out to perfection. And of course, the size: it is just too good. 35.5mm diameter with 6.8mm thickness it will slide underneath just about any cuffs. 

The significance that Abraham Louis Breguet had in the industry is very much relevant to this day, with the invention of the Tourbillon, Breguet overcoil, engine turned dial (Guilloché) and plenty more. In my opinion Breguet had their new "peak" when Daniel Roth came to the brand after his time at Audemars Piguet and created some of the best pieces the brand has produced after the rebirth of the brand under Jacques and Pierre Chaumet. This 3330, although not released during the Daniel Roth era of Breguet, still has all the DNA from that golden age of Breguet. Beautiful coin edge case, 2 different types of Guilloché pattern, 36mm dimension with only 6.8mm in thickness, it is the dictionary type of proportion for classic dress watches. Although Breguet still produces the successor of this design with the reference 7337, it has a fatter 39mm case size as well as unproportionate dial construction which unfortunately seems to be the case for a lot of big brands.
